<p> By 1531 these coins were still being minted, by now in both Seville and <a href="page.php?w=Burgos">Burgos</a>. These maravedís were used as Spanish Colonial change for smaller transactions and after mints were later established in the New World, in both <a href="page.php?w=Mexican_Mint">Mexico</a> (ordered in 1535, production began in 1536) and <a href="page.php?w=Santo_Domingo">Santo Domingo</a> (ordered in 1536, production began in 1542), coins of this type were also minted there. </p>
